About Hampden Hills Post AcuteHampden Hills Post Acute is located at 14699 E Hampden Ave, Aurora, CO, reachable at (303) 693-0111. This For profit – Corporation facility operates 218.0 certified beds and serves an average of 195 residents per day. It is part of the The Ensign Group network (329 facilities nationwide). Medicare and Medicaid services have been provided since 1977-05-02. The facility currently holds a below average (2-star) overall CMS rating — families are encouraged to review inspection reports carefully before making a decision.

Staffing InsightHampden Hills Post Acute currently provides 3 hours 18 minutes of total nurse staffing per resident per day, including 26 minutes of Registered Nurse (RN) coverage. The CMS Staffing Rating is 3 out of 5 (average). RN hours per resident have declined from 44 min/day (2022) to 26 min/day (2026) — a trend families should be aware of. Total nursing staff turnover is 27.2%, near the national average.

Compliance SummaryThe facility has received 15 fine(s) over the 5-year period, totaling $447,967. 97 substantiated complaints were recorded across the 5-year period — families should request details from the facility or review CMS inspection findings.

Hampden Hills Post Acute is certified as a Medicare and Medicaid facility and has been approved to provide these services since 1977-05-02. Medicare covers short-term skilled nursing care (typically up to 100 days after a qualifying hospital stay). Medicaid covers long-term care for residents who meet financial eligibility requirements. Contact the facility at (303) 693-0111 or your local Medicaid office to verify current eligibility.

Hampden Hills Post Acute holds an overall CMS (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services) rating of 2 out of 5 stars. This is made up of three components: Health Inspection (2★), Staffing (3★), and Quality of Resident Care (3★). Each resident at Hampden Hills Post Acute receives a reported average of 3 hours 18 minutes of total nurse staffing per day. This breaks down as: Registered Nurse (RN) coverage — 26 minutes; Licensed Practical Nurse (LPN) — 44 minutes; Nurse Aide — 2 hours 8 minutes. On weekends, total nurse staffing is 3 hours 4 minutes per resident per day. The CMS Staffing Rating for this facility is 3 out of 5. The national average for total nursing hours is approximately 3.5 hrs/day. Total nursing staff turnover is 27.2%.
